Used in good condition: no dust jacket; cover and pages have very light wear; pages are lightly age-toned. 

Half a Hundred Tales by Great American Writers is a collection of fifty short stories written by some of the most renowned American authors. Edited by Charles Grayson, this book offers a diverse range of literary styles and themes, showcasing the talent and creativity of American writers. The stories cover a variety of topics such as love, loss, family, society, and the human condition.

     Some of the authors featured in this collection include Edgar Allan Poe, Mark Twain, Nathaniel Hawthorne, Herman Melville, and O. Henry. Each story is a masterpiece in its own right, offering readers a glimpse into the world of American literature. This book is perfect for anyone who loves short stories and wants to explore the works of some of the greatest American writers of all time.

     Partial Author List: Conrad Aiken; Louis Bromfield; James M. Cain; John Cheever; Marc Connelly; James Gould Cozzens; J. Frank Dobie; William Faulkner; Waldo Frank; Erle Stanley Gardner; James Norman Hall; Dashell Hammett; Ernest Haycox; Ben Hecht; Ernest Hemingway; Joseph Hergesheimer; Paul Horgan; Cyril Hume; Nunnally Johnson; Mackinlay Kantor; Rufus King; John P. Marquand; Christopher Morley; Ernie Pyle; Ellery Queen; John Russell; Irwin Shaw; John Steinbeck; Jesse Stuart; James Thurber; Thornton Wilder and many more.
